Hurricanes rack up losses for Berkshire Hathaway

By Dan Roberts in New York

Published: November 5 2004 23:38 | Last updated: November 5 2004 23:38

Hurricanes in Florida and the Carribbean cost Warren Buffet’s Berkshire Hathaway investment group $1.25bn in pre-tax insurance losses this summer.

The higher-than-expected impact of four big storms meant quarterly earnings slipped for the third quarter in a row, falling from $1.8bn to $1.1bn.
